Days of the Pioneer Antique ShowSep 14, 2012 - Sep 15, 2012
Day of the Pioneer is an 18th and 19th century antique show to benefit the Museum of Appalachia. This premier antique show features the finest selection of early antiques from dealers across the country. Admission also includes a tour of the Museum of Appalachia, demonstrations from pioneer craftsmen, traditional cooking, informal mountain music throughout the grounds and a Civil War encampment.
